لوحات التحكم بالسيرفرات البدائل المجانية ومقارنتها بـلوحة cPanel


(مجاهد الطحلة) #1

بسم الله الرحمن الرحيم
اسعد الله مساءكم احباءنا في كل مكان
هذا هو المقال الثاني في هذه القناة وسأتحدث فيه عن لوحات التحكم الخاصة بإدارة السيرفرات (Web Control Panel)
حيث ساتحدث عن المحاور التالية:

  • كيف يمكن ان اجد البدائل المتوفرة لأي تطبيق او خدمة على الانترنت
  • تعداد بدائل الـcPanel المجانية المفتوحة التي تمت تجربتها شخصياً
  • مقارنة سريعة بين البدائل المفتوحة المصدر وبين الـcPanel حسب تجربتي

سأقوم بتقسيم الموضوع الى سلسلة اتحدث في كل مرة عن احد اجزاء هذا الموضوع
وهذا هو الجزء الأول من مقال اليوم وسأكمل البقية في اقرب وقت ان شاء الله ولنبدأ على بركة الله:

تقريبا جميع التطبيقات والبرامج والخدمات التقنية المدفوعة الخاصة بالكمبيوتر والسيرفرات والهواتف الذكية في شتى المجالات لها بدائل مجانية وكثيراً ما تكون هذه البدائل مفتوحة المصدر، أما عن كيفية العثور عليها فهذا ما سأوضحه في هذا الموضوع. باختصار هذه العملية بغاية السهولة وذلك باستخدام موقع http://alternativeto.net الذي يحتوي محرك بحث خاص لايجاد البدائل البرمجية
فقط ادخل على الموقع واكتب في مربع البحث اسم التطبيق او الخدمة الالكترونية التي تبحث لها عن بديل وفي حالتنا فنحن نبحث عن بديل للوحة التحكم الاكثر شهرة الـcPanel

وباستخدام خيار الفلترة المتوفر بالموقع فانه بالامكان الاختيار ما بين نظم التشغيل او بيئة العمل المراد العمل عليها


(Windows,Linux, Mobile,web…)
ايضا من نفس القائمة يوجد خيار للتحديد ما بين التراخيص التالية:
١- مجاني او مفتوح المصدر Free Or Open Source
٢- مفتوح المصدر فقط Only Open Source
٣-رخصة تجارية Commercial

انا قمت باختيار عرض البدائل مفتوحة المصدر فقط
وهذا ما حصلت عليه

البدائل التي قمت بتجرتبها شخصيا هي التالية:
١- Webmin
٢-Ajenti
٣- Vesta Control Panel
٤- CentOS Web Panel
٥- ZPanel و التي توقف تطويرها ثم اشتقت منها Sentora

طبعا هذه ليست هي البدائل الوحيدة في الموقع لكن هذا ما تسنى لي تجربته اثناء وتثبيتها على السيرفرات التي املكها واستخدمت بعض منها في الماضي او في الفترة الحالية مع ملاحظة ان جميع هذه اللوحات تعمل على بيئة تشغيل Linux
لكن الصحيح انه لا يوجد بديل ١٠٠٪ عن لوحة الـcPanel لما تقدمه من خيارات متنوعة وكثيرة يعرفها مدراء السيرفرات وتسهيلات كبيرة للعمل يدركونها اكثر من المستخدم النهائي للوحة التحكم

فعلى سبيل المثال ومن خلال تجربتي الشخصية للوحة Webmin فمعظم الخيارات التي تقدمها مع كثرتها والتي قد لا تجدها في لوحة الـcPanel الا انها لا تصلح للمستخدم المبتدأ وتحتاج شخص خبير ويتقن العمل اصلا بدون لوحة التحكم فما تضيفه هو فقط واجهة رسومية للمهام التي غالبا ما يقوم بها مدير النظام من خلال سطر الاوامر لكن كما قلت فهي تحتوي على خصائص واوامر اضافية غير متوفرة في لوحة الـcPanel مثل الوصول الى بعض قطع الهاردوير في السيرفر بشكل مباشر وتغيير اعداداتها مثل تغيير اعدادات الشبكة كاملة من IP و Gateway و Routing table وغيرها .
او الوصول المباشر لجميع المستخدمين على النظام او حتى ادارة الطابعات او قارئ الاقراص المدمج المتصل بالسيرفر.
ومن سلبياتها مقارنه بلوحة الـcPanel فهي غير صالحة لمن ينوي العمل في تأجير استضافات الويب المشتركة، فلا يوجد خيار لاضافة خطط استضافة وانشاء حسابات للمشتركين بالسهولة التي تقدما الـcPanel ولا يوجد مجال لاضافة ريسيلر على السيرفر كما انها لا تقدم الكثير من الخيارات المطلوبة في الاستضافة المشتركة لادارة قواعد البيانات كما في الـcPanel
لكنها تبقى خيار مناسب جداً اذا كان المستفيد الأول والأخير هو مؤسسة ما او شركة بعينها او شخص واحد وكان يعلم مالذي يفعله حتى اذا كان السيرفر يحتوي خدمات متعددة (لكن غير مشتركة كما قلنا) كاستضافة مواقع خاصة باصحاب العمل على سيرفر شخصي او تطبيق بروكسي مثل squid او سيرفر محادثات فورية باستخدام سيرفر Jabber الذي يعتمد على بروتوكل XMPP او سيرفر VPN باستخدام بروتوكلي L2TP او PPTP وغيرها وجميع هذه الخدمات بالاضافة الى خدمات اخرى يوجد لها بشكل افتراضي مكان لوحة Webmin لتسهيل التحكم بها

على عكس لوحة الـcPanel فهذه اللوحة تعمل على عدة توزيعات لنكس وانا جربتها مع توزيعتي CentOS و ubuntu وليس فقط centos .

الخلاصة انني لا انصح بها للمبتدأين ولا لمن يفكر في أن يؤسس عملا يقوم على بيع خدمات ويب وخدمات تقنية مشتركة.
الى هنا أصل لنهاية الحديث عن لوحة Webmin وسأتحدث عن البقية في أقرب وقت ان شاء الله

انتظروني…
واحب ان انوه ان الحقوق محفوظة لجميع المشتركين في قناة ومجموعة “ادارة السيرفرات والشبكات” على تيلجيرام بالاضافة لمجتمع أسس بشكل خاص وبشرط ذكر المصدر عند النقل

ولا تنسوا انه بامكانكم طرح الاسئلة او الاستفسارات او اقتراح افكار ومواضيع من خلال مجموعة ادارة السيرفرات والشبكات من هنا
https://telegram.me/asysadmins
او من خلال التعليقات هنا


(مجاهد الطحلة) #2

الجزء الثاني:- تلخيصاً لما سبق فقد طرحت عليكم إحدى الطرق المتبعة للعثور عن البدائل لأي تطبيق او برنامج إن كان تطبيق ويب او غيره وذلك باستخدام موقع alternativeto.net، ثم استخدمنا هذا الموقع للبحث عن بدائل مفتوحة المصدر للوحة التحكم cPanel وحصلنا على عدة نتائج اخترت لكم من بينها اللوحات التالية بسبب اني اعطيتها حقها في التجربة:
‏‫١-Webmin‬
‏‫٢-Ajenti‬
‏‫٣-Vesta Control Panel‬
‏‫٤-CentOS Web Panel ‬
‏‫٥- ZPanel أو Sentora‬
‫ومن هذه القائمة تكلمت في المرة الماضية عن لوحة Webmin على أساس المقارنة بينها وبين لوحة cPanel ويمكن الرجوع للموضوع من هنا للاطلاع على كامل التفاصيل التي تخص ذلك المقال من هنا‬
‏‫https://telegram.me/arabsysadmins/20‬
و‫اليوم سأكمل حديثي وسأتكلم بشكل سريع ومختصر أيضاً عن لوحة Ajenti مع المحافظة على وضوح وفائدة المضمون للجميع قدر المستطاع.‬

‫في البداية فإن لوحة Ajenti لوحة رائعة،متكاملة وسهلة الاستخدام وقد تكاد تكون هي اللوحة الوحيدة المبنية باستخدام لغة البرمجة Python في حين ان معظم اللوحات تستخدم فيها لغة PHP أو ASP.NET للويندوز.‬
‫أما استخدامتها فهي تضم الكثير من الخيارات والأوامر في إدارة النظام نفسه فتتجاوز بذلك اقتصارها على التحكم بالخدمات المتعلقة باستضافة وتشغيل المواقع Web Hosting Services.‬
‫مما يميزها ايضاً انها مدعومة بشكل كامل على اكثر من توزيعة لينكس ويمكن تنصيبها باستخدام سكريبت تنصيب مؤتمت على انظمة التشغيل التالية:‬

  • Ubuntu Precise or later
  • Debian 6 or later
  • CentOS 6 or later
  • RHEL 6 or later
    ‫كما يمكن تشغيلها على انظمة لينكس المختلفة لكن باستخدام التنصيب اليدوي وقد لا يتوفر الدعم لبعضها من قبل المطورين ‬
    ‫أيضاً يتوفر لها العديد من الإضافات plugins التي لتتيح للمستخدم التحكم بالخدمات الأخرى المتوفرة على السيرفر فعلى سبيل المثال لا الحصر اذا كان لديك خدمة OpenVPN على السيرفر فيمكن تثبيت الاضافة الخاصة بها والتحكم في تشغيلها وايقافها…‬
    ‫بالإضافة إلى العديد من خدمات الويب والشبكات مثل dhcp server او smb server… الخ من الخدمات والأوامر والبرامج ولذلك قلنا انها غير مقتصرة على التحكم بخدمات الويب فقط، كما انها تقدم بعض الخدمات المفيدة للمطورين مثل خدمة استضافة مستودعات البرمجة git repos او ال svn.‬
    ‫يعيب اللوحة أنها بطيئة نسبياً في الاستجابة عند التنقل من صفحة الى أخرى في داخلها او عند طلب بعض الاوامر.‬
    ‫وبالعودة الى استضافة المواقع فاللوحة تقدم حلاً جيداً لاستضافة اكثر من موقع بسهولة لكن بعد تثبيت الاضافة الخاصة بالاستضافة ajenti-v والتي تعتمد سيرفر الويب ngnix. لكن للاسف لا توفر المميزات المطلوبة لمن يرغبون في اتخاذ استضافة المواقع كمصدر دخل، فلا يوجد حسابات موزعين resellers ولا خطط استضافة.‬
    ‫من ناحيتي لا افضل استخدامها اطلاقاً ولا انصح بها إلا لمن يريد استضافة مواقع خاصة ولا يهتم كثيرا بالمميزات الاضافية المتواجدة في اللوحات المشهورة مثل cPanel وplesk وغيرها. خلاصة القول ‬
    ‫الإيجابيات:‬
    ‫-سهولة في التعامل‬
    ‫-سهولة في التثبيت‬
    ‫-دعم اكثر من توزيعة‬
    ‫-واجهة جميلة‬
    ‫-امكانية التحكم باكثر من خدمة عن طريق الاضافات‬
    ‫السلبيات:‬
    ‫-بطء في الاستجابة‬
    ‫-قلة في الامكانيات والمميزات بما يخص الاستضافة‬

‫الاسئلة بخصوص الموضوع يتم طرحها هنا او من خلال مجموعتي الخاصة على التيليجرام‬
‏‫ ‬https://telegram.me/asysadmins
الموقع الرسمي للوحة:
‏http://ajenti.org/
ارجو اني اكون وفقت اني اضيف لكم بعض الفائدة والمعلومات الجديدة
م. مجاهد الطحلة
‏#ArabSysAdmins
#لوحات_التحكم_بالسيرفرات

‫ ‬